The Art of Conservation

Baumgartner Fine Art Restoration is more than a studio; it's a sanctuary for art. The focus is not just on repairing, but on conserving, ensuring that the essence of the artwork is preserved for future generations. The use of reversible, archival materials is a testament to their commitment to authenticity and longevity.
